[keycloak-user] Keycloak Social Login

Marek Posolda mposolda at redhat.com
Mon Mar 13 05:00:32 EDT 2017


Yes, I think that writing custom authenticator, which will be able to 
login you based on the Facebook token, will be the best for now. Maybe 
we should have something better OOTB for this usecase, but we don't have 
AFAIK.

Marek

On 12/03/17 12:49, Matthew Woolnough wrote:
> Anunay, did you get any answers to these questions? I would like to know
> the answers to the posed questions also.
>
>
> On 11 February 2017 at 00:09, Anunay Sinha <anunay.sinha at arvindinternet.com>
> wrote:
>
>> Hi
>> I am using keycloak as security layer and working towards enabling social
>> login.
>> Social login was working and I was able to integrate Facebook with just
>> configurations using the doicuments.
>>
>> However I have a requirement where in I need to provide an API end points
>> for the same.
>> Our mobile devices will be communicating to facebook via the app and will
>> have the token from the facebook (Implicit Flow).
>> I will then be exchanging the token with keycloak for the keycloak access
>> token.
>>
>> I have two questions
>> 1. Is this approach correct, if not why
>> 2. How can I achieve this. I was thinking of writing a custom authenticator
>> (Am not sure if thats the right approoach as I have to register user are
>> well if FB Access token user is not available with us (We can afford to
>> login user and with jsut emailID as we can onbaord new users later)
>>
>> I am blocked because authenticator is not working with any build from 2.4.0
>> onwards
>>
>> Let me know if my approach is correct and if so how to proceed about it.
>> _______________________________________________
>> keycloak-user mailing list
>> keycloak-user at lists.jboss.org
>> https://lists.jboss.org/mailman/listinfo/keycloak-user
>>
> _______________________________________________
> keycloak-user mailing list
> keycloak-user at lists.jboss.org
> https://lists.jboss.org/mailman/listinfo/keycloak-user




More information about the keycloak-user mailing list